feat(user): 添加用户修改密码功能
- 在前端 HomePage 组件中添加修改密码对话框 - 在 API 中添加 updatePassword 接口 - 在后端 UserController 中添加密码更新接口 - 在 UserService 中添加 updatePassword 方法 - 实现密码更新逻辑,包括旧密码验证和新密码加密
This commit is contained in:
@@ -0,0 +1,19 @@
|
||||
package com.test.bijihoudaun.bo;
|
||||
|
||||
import io.swagger.v3.oas.annotations.media.Schema;
|
||||
import lombok.Data;
|
||||
|
||||
import java.io.Serializable;
|
||||
|
||||
@Data
|
||||
@Schema(description = "更新密码业务对象")
|
||||
public class UpdatePasswordBo implements Serializable {
|
||||
|
||||
private static final long serialVersionUID = 1L;
|
||||
|
||||
@Schema(description = "旧密码", name = "oldPassword", requiredMode = Schema.RequiredMode.REQUIRED)
|
||||
private String oldPassword;
|
||||
|
||||
@Schema(description = "新密码", name = "newPassword", requiredMode = Schema.RequiredMode.REQUIRED)
|
||||
private String newPassword;
|
||||
}
|
||||
Reference in New Issue
Block a user